Transaction 59700a25ba17422f260876dcbe42683b4d45ed437afe4de8a75373a9b386b034
1 Input
1 Output
-
59700a25ba17422f260876dcbe42683b4d45ed437afe4de8a75373a9b386b034:0
- value
- 211608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 604333eabc106a44136eadd1019b9ed640335a55 OP_EQUAL
- address
- 3AU1JHtFMiT3srtRQ4E1HbLZocY56nQJwV